In Memorium

560a1424a0a2e_image.jpg We are saddened to report the passing of our good friend James A. Getty on Sept. 26th in Gettysburg.
Jim was best known to all of us for his magnificent portrayal of our 16th President.
Born in Fairbury, Ill on Jan. 17, 1932, he grew up in Colfax, Ill and received degrees from Illinois Wesleyan University, where he met his wife Joanne. They married in 1952.
Jim was a Navy Veteran, serving in the Korean War.
Before moving to Gettysburg in 1977, he taught choral music in several schools, and directed choirs as well.
For the past four decades, his career has been devoted strictly towards his portrayal of Abraham Lincoln.
He is survived by his wife, children, grand children, as well as great and great-great grandchildren.
Jim was 83. RIP.
